I'm thinking of doing something similar to one of my Senior Telemaster kits (95" version). I figure adding a bottom wing would make it look something like a squarish cabin bipe of the Thirties.
While it would be more efficient to reduce the thickness of the wings in a full scale aircraft, because we modelers fly in a rather small place where building up speed only means that you have to turn sooner, I like my models to be draggy. Leaving the airfoil stock permits me to use the existing wing ribs, etc., which saves me money and aggravation. I tend to add drag to my models intentionally. Lots of drag also means that it is easier to fly from smaller spaces.
